The WNBA season is true across the nook, and free company is lastly right here. The free company negotiation interval begins on Wednesday, April eighth, and groups can start signing free brokers to new contracts on Saturday, April 11.
Earlier than this, qualifying gives and core participant designations have been despatched out on April sixth and seventh.
Reserved gamers are gamers who’re out of contract with three years of service or fewer. In the event that they obtain a Reserved qualifying provide, these gamers are topic to that group’s unique negotiating rights. If the membership declines to supply the participant a contract, they turn out to be unrestricted free brokers.
Restricted free brokers are gamers with at the least 4 years of service whose contract has expired, and who obtain a qualifying provide from their earlier group. These gamers can negotiate with different groups, however their unique group can match any provide.
A Core Designation is the WNBA’s model of a franchise tag. A company can have one veteran free agent whom they’ve cored on their roster — and thus provided a completely assured one-year deal definitely worth the supermax. If a participant receives a Core Designation, they will solely signal or negotiate a contract with that group in the course of the free company interval.
